]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- lib/cpumask.c
cpumask: introduce new API, without changing anything, v3
[linux-2.6-omap-h63xx.git] / lib / cpumask.c
index 2ebc3a9a74655f4cf65431c40c4b65e11059789c..8d03f22c6ced0176c3f2c368f58b3a167918a86e 100644 (file)
@@ -67,6 +67,7 @@ int cpumask_any_but(const struct cpumask *mask, unsigned int cpu)
 {
        unsigned int i;
 
+       cpumask_check(cpu);
        for_each_cpu(i, mask)
                if (i != cpu)
                        break;
@@ -108,7 +109,7 @@ void free_cpumask_var(cpumask_var_t mask)
 }
 EXPORT_SYMBOL(free_cpumask_var);
 
-void free_bootmem_cpumask_var(cpumask_var_t mask)
+void __init free_bootmem_cpumask_var(cpumask_var_t mask)
 {
        free_bootmem((unsigned long)mask, cpumask_size());
 }